TWO MEMBERS of the Davinder Bambiha gang, which is being operated by a fugitive gangster Lucky Patial, were arrested from Chandigarh on Wednesday night, with police recovering two .32 bore pistols and seven live cartridges from their possession...

The second man was identified as Vikas Maan alias Tau, 25, of Karnal, who is a law graduate..

After preliminary interrogation of the two accused, the police said that they have learnt that they had come to Chandigarh to eliminate one of their former associates, Baljeet Chaudhary..

When the police team reached near Sanatan Dharam Mandir in Sector 37C, they received a tip-off from an informer who said that Shivam and Vikas were headed to Chandigarh..

The arrest of the two gangsters Shivam and Vikas on Wednesday came two days after the National Investigation Agency (NIA) raided the house of fugitive gangster, Lucky Patial, in Khuda Lahora village in Chandigarh..
